The most awe-inspiring day hike you can do in New Zealand. It may be a little hard, but most definitely worth it!

The all-encompassing panorama from this 1,578 m summit includes most of Lake Wanaka, the surrounding peaks of the Southern Alps including Mount Aspiring. After crossing through paddocks, the well-graded track continues through alpine tussock to the ridge. In winter there is snow, but the hike can be still be done.

The hike takes 5-6 hours all up and is 16km (10 miles) round trip.
